AMECO is Hiring a Warehouse Technician I Near Harrison, OH

Job Description

Job Description

AMECO is looking to hire an experienced and highly motivated Warehouse Technician to work out of our Harrison, OH distribution facility. As a Warehouse Technician you will be responsible for efficiently and accurately performing a broad range of warehouse duties related to the receipt, shipment, storage, distribution or delivery of products and general warehouse maintenance. Based on our small team environment, dependability is critical, including the ability to work overtime when needed. This is a day shift position.

Key Responsibilities:

Receiving/Stocking:

  • Count product and verify against packing list
  • Accurately receive product utilizing RF scan gun and/or in accordance with procedures
  • Reports and notes shortages or damages
  • Organize/stage items in preparation for stocking or shipping
  • Load, unload, move or store product according to delivery or routing documents or supervisor instructions
  • Verify proper placement (bin location) and stock product accordingly
  • Rotate and replenish stock as required

Picking/Packing:

  • Using an RF scan gun, pull orders accurately by verifying location and part number against RF gun and picklist.
  • Meet minimum pick rate of 20 lines per hour picked
  • Stage pulled orders in appropriate staging areas: freight, ground, will call
  • Reports and notes inventory discrepancies to lead associates for additional research

Other duties:

  • Organize and complete appropriate paperwork relating to the receipt, storage, or distribution of materials
  • Exercise general warehouse maintenance to ensure cleanliness/appearance/safety
  • Continually exercise precautions to protect warehouse contents again damage or loss
  • Establish and maintain a positive working relationship with internal/external customers
  • Cross train and perform back-up duties for other warehouse associates as requested
  • Complete equipment inspection checklists daily, prior to use of equipment.
  • Establishes and maintains a positive working relationship with team members and internal/external customers.
  • Complies with all company policies/procedures and safety guidelines
  • Ensures work areas are organized efficiently while maintaining security/safety measures.
  • Upholds AMECO’s productivity, quality, and safety standards.
  • Performs all other duties as assigned.

Education Requirements: High School diploma or GED.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Qualified candidates must have a minimum of one-year general warehouse experience
  • Able to drive and safely operate a forklift, stock picker and electronic pallet jack in accordance with 29 CFR 1910.178
  • Experience using bar code readers, computer terminals (computer literate) and/or other electronic devices
  • Solid mathematical abilities/aptitude
  • Capable of working at a fast pace, with excellent time management skills
  • Self-motivated, self-reliant, able to work with little direction
  • Reliable/dependable (prompt, with good attendance)
  • Capable of multi-tasking and flexible to change direction or focus as priorities dictate

Certifications, Licenses, Registration: Previous license operating a forklift AND stock picker.

Supervisory Responsibilities: None

Physical Demands/Requirements: The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

Based on the type of equipment we work on, the job is physical and labor intensive, i.e., heavy lifting, climbing on equipment and grinding out of position. Individuals will be required to frequently sit/drive stand, walk, lift/carry, reach, stoop, push/pull, handle/grasp/feel, talk, hear, climb step ladder, engage in repetitive motions, and demonstrate eye/hand/foot coordination. Close vision is required for this job. Employees are required to regularly lift, carry and/or move up to 25 pounds and occasionally up to 50 pounds. Position frequently demands light to heavy physical work. All positions require standing over 90% of the day.

Who are we: AMECO is a full-service, global supplier of vehicles, construction equipment, tools, support services, and asset management solutions across multiple industries and government agencies. At AMECO, expertise is the commitment to provide the highest levels of knowledge and experience in all areas of the business, utilizing the company’s resources to provide the expertise Clients need.

We have a proven track record of delivering increased productivity, cost reduction, schedule certainty, and performance reliability on project sites and in operating facilities throughout North America. AMECO delivers expertise in managing significant work scopes related to construction indirect products and services for capital construction project owners, contractors, and government, as well as ongoing plant operation support with an emphasis on oil, gas, chemicals, mining, power, pharmaceutical/ biotech, general manufacturing, and infrastructure end markets.
